Transaction 115036141dba064e2a0acbffffd8545facb3b293d2acd5720e5183f2d1637d66

3 Input
1 Outputs
  • 115036141dba064e2a0acbffffd8545facb3b293d2acd5720e5183f2d1637d66:0
  • value  78445119
    address  3CJAaNwWPa66tNbF6N9ZrnJcJKhq9me4u4